Output 73626bfbbff8d7b8d71d21f5d242c63d60ee51397e599375dd6fa3a5bbafc0a6:1

value
2574916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d634ad31d0879b3ccb6b58ffc6a8fc1ccf5e45db OP_EQUAL
address
3MDdddFBWywoxKzL4eXatuWxyey4RnGrzj
transaction
73626bfbbff8d7b8d71d21f5d242c63d60ee51397e599375dd6fa3a5bbafc0a6
spent
true